Quantity Surveyor

Job Description

Position: Quantity Surveyor / Senior Quantity Surveyor (Permanent) - Social Housing
Location: Bristol
Package: £45,000 - £55,000 Basic + Car/Travel Allowance


Reporting to: Commercial Manager

Purpose
The day to day administration of contracts as assigned to include full invoicing, cost reconciliation and reporting responsibility.
To ensure prompt conversion of works from WIP to invoice and cash in order to reduce risk, building relationships with Clients in order to assist.
Offer support to other departments with regards to commercial/contractual issues, working closely with other Quantity Surveyors, the Commercial Manager and Operations Manager.

Responsibilities
Carry out measurement, application, agree/resolve disputes, invoice and resolve invoice queries to convert from WIP through to cash.
Ensure that all jobs costs are charged correctly including timesheets, purchase invoices and subcontractor costs.
Ensure that the administration of Sub-contracts is at all times optimised.
Offer guidance and manage the above process for other contracts within the team in order to ensure internal targets are met.
Build relationships and rapports internally across departments and externally with clients to assist the above processes.
On a contract by contract basis, ensure we have the controls to manage the following, in accordance with internal targets;
Our WIP effectively
Our debt effectively
Our profitability
Be involved in producing a local budget, using past performance to help with forecasting, sense checking that it is both realistic and challenging.
Produce monthly cash flow forecasts per contract where required
Ensure that our commercial and financial processes & systems are maintained and adhered to locally.
As and when required, participate in the commercial element of local bid process or contract review.
To assist as required and where necessary with any commercially related functions
Any other Quantity Surveyor duties

Experience/knowledge required
Proven main contractor experience working as a Quantity Surveyor/ Senior Quantity Surveyor in a commercial role on refurb, response & planned maintenance contracts within the social housing sector.
Knowledge and understanding of measurement and valuation including use of Schedule of Rates.
Commercial skills to maximise value recovery and control cost
Good communication and time management skills
Knowledge and understanding of contractual obligations under various forms of contract
Excellent IT skills including the use of internal cost systems and particularly advanced in Excel.
